An iceberg order is a large trade instruction split into smaller visible portions, where only a fraction of the total order quantity is displayed in the market's order book at any given time. As each visible slice gets executed, the next portion automatically becomes visible, making the full order size invisible to other market participants. Institutional investors and large traders use iceberg orders to avoid signalling their full buying or selling intent to the market, which could move prices adversely against them before the order is complete. On Indian exchanges like NSE and BSE, iceberg orders are supported through advanced order management systems available on professional trading platforms.
